| Man arrested with 50 live cartridges at Airport | | | Jammu, Mar 24 Panic gripped Jammu Airport, this afternoon, when an Indian Airlines passenger on way to Leh was arrested with fifty live cartridges by the security personnel on guard duty. Official sources informed that the security personnel deployed on the airport arrested a man who was to board Jammu-Leh flight. Giving details, a senior police officer told NAK that one Sham Lal son of Ramolla resident of Udhampur was among the passengers who had to board Jammu-Leh flight when he was arrested. When the luggage of Lal was examined in the X-Ray machine police noticed a box inside and asked him to open the bag. On opening the bag police noticed 50 live cartridges of .22 bore gun. The suspect was immediately taken into custody by Anti-Hijacking wing of Jammu police who subjected him to sustained interrogation. It was reliably learnt that the accused during his questioning has revealed that one of his friend from Leh had handed over a packed bag containing these cartages. “My friend has already flown to Leh with licensed weapon and I was unaware about the cartridges in the bag”, the accused told police. “Sham Lal did not know that he is carrying live cartridges along with him”, a security official said adding when he was arrested he got stunt as why he was being taken into custody. A report from Leh Police in this regard was awaited, so as to ascertain the facts and the authenticity of the person whom Sham Lal named. Police has registered a case FIR No 30 of 2007 under section 3/25 of Arms Act.
